A silver Roman denarius of Carausius (AD 286-293), dating to the period AD 286-293 (Reece period 14). ADVENTVS AV(ICIII or IIIII) reverse type depicting Carausius, draped, cuirassed, riding left, raising right hand and holding  sceptre in left hand. Mint unclear. The exergue is almost entirely off the flan, so it is not possible to determine if the exergue is clear or marked with RSR. The reverse legend is normally ADVENTVS AVG, but the end of the legend is blundered, However, the coin is regular.  RIC V, pt 2, p. 508, cf. no.…

A damaged and incomplete silver denarius of Septimius Severus (AD 193-211) dating to AD 210-211. VICTORIAE BRIT reverse type depicting Victory, winged, draped, standing left, holding wreath in extended right hand and palm sloped over left shoulder in left hand. Mint of Rome. As RIC IV Septimius Severus 333 Measurements: 18.2mm diameter, 1.3mm thickness, weight 2.1g.
